Starting at Puerto Rico: A Flexible Afternoon Departure

The tour begins in Puerto Rico, with a departure time of 3:30 pm, making it ideal for those who prefer a late start rather than an early morning. The boat departs from Puerto Rico harbor, sailing along the southwest coast of Gran Canaria. Travelers enjoy sights of beaches, caves, villages, and other coastal features during the cruise, gaining a scenic overview of this part of the island.

The return is to the same meeting point, closing a loop around the coast. The afternoon timing provides the chance to see the coastline in different light conditions, especially as the sun begins to dip, which some reviews highlight as a beautiful sunset experience.

The Itinerary and Water Stops on the Catamaran

The trip features two swim stops, giving ample opportunity to swim, snorkel, or use the complimentary kayaks and stand-up paddleboards. These stops are carefully planned along the coast, offering a chance to explore underwater life or relax on the boat.

Beyond the included activities, extra options like jet skis and parasailing are available at additional costs, offering an adrenaline boost for those wanting more excitement. During the cruise, drinks and snacks are served, including beer, sangria, soft drinks, and water, creating a casual, party-like atmosphere on deck.

Extra Costs and Optional Activities

While most activities are included, certain extras are available at additional costs. These include jet skis and parasailing, which provide more adrenaline for thrill-seekers. The tour does not include coffee or tea, but cocktails, wine, and champagne can be purchased separately.

Guests should be aware that cancellation is free if done 24 hours in advance, but the tour is dependent on good weather conditions for safety and enjoyment.

Practical Details: Meeting Point and Accessibility

The meeting point is conveniently located in Gran Canaria, Las Palmas, with near public transportation options. The pickup service adds convenience, especially for those staying in the area. The tour starts at 3:30 pm and concludes back at the original meeting point.

The activity is suitable for most travelers, and service animals are allowed. The group size cap of 20 helps ensure a relaxed environment, but it’s important to note that the tour may not be suitable for individuals with mobility issues or those seeking a more vigorous adventure.
